(3S,5S)-Atorvastatin
Based on 1 Customer Validation
(3S,5S)-Atorvastatin is a inactive enantiomer of Atorvastatin. (3S,5S)-Atorvastatin can activate pregnane X receptor (PXR). Atorvastatin is an orally active HMG-CoA reductase inhibitor, has the ability to effectively decrease blood lipids.

Biological Activity
Pregnane X receptor (PXR)[1]
Atorvastatin and its inactive enantiomer (3S,5S)-Atorvastatin increases CYP2B and CYP3A mRNA content with equal ability[1].
(3S,5S)-Atorvastatin in 100 μM concentrations induces luciferase activity with an EC50 of 12.4 μM[2].
Addition of (3S,5S)-Atorvastatin to the 2-formylphenylboronic
acid (FPBA)/l-tryptophanol mixture induces an intensity enhancement of l-tryptophanol florescence[3].
